From Jeff Wilson:

Danny Duffy turned 35 in December, not old but no longer a spring chicken.

That's especially so after three injury-plagued seasons, including 2023 with the Rangers on a minor-league deal.

His search to see if he had something left took him to Puerto Rico over the winter for a stint with los Cangrejeros de Santruce. After not allowing a regular-season earned run over 15 2/3 innings, he discovered that he did.

Duffy took another minor-league deal to return to Rangers camp, and he is a bona-fide contender to make the Opening Day roster. He is being evaluated for the fifth spot in the rotation, along with fellow left-hander Cody Bradford and at least six others, but is happy to pitch in the bullpen if needed.

The Rangers need multi-inning relievers, too.

"Until further notice, the plan is to get me stretched out," Duffy said. "I went down there to prove to myself that my arm could take the volume of a starter. I know I can pitch out of the 'pen. Whatever the team needs, I'm down for it."

Duffy said that he hasn't felt as good as he does now since May of 2021, the last of his 11 seasons with the Royals. He had a 2.51 ERA after 13 games/12 starts before his elbow started barking, ultimately resulting in offseason surgery for a torn flexor tendon.

From Evan Grant:

Starting pitching is fragile. It’s why GM Chris Young should start wearing a chain with his mantra: “You can never have enough starting pitching.” Might be too big to fit.

There is also an abundance of high-profile pitching prospects in camp. Two former first-rounders: Cole Winn and Jack Leiter. A second-rounder: Owen White And Zak Kent, a guy with perhaps a better breaking ball than all of them.

The issue is this: Is anybody from the second group ready to be an adequate fill-in when the inevitable happens to somebody from the first?

That’s what the Rangers are going to try to decipher this spring.

“I think it’s a great opportunity for them to do that,” manager Bruce Bochy said Thursday. “We want to get them the work they need and give us a chance to get a good look at them and put them in situations they are going to be in at some point this year, if not the start. I want them to come in and not just make a great impression but give us a tough decision.”

Let us suggest a slight edit. There isn’t just a great opportunity to make an impression; the Rangers need at least one to do so.

“Yeah,” Bochy acknowledged. “It would be big for us.”

From Adam Morris:

There’s part of me that keeps thinking, surely the Rangers are going to make another move to get someone who can start in here. Blake Snell and Jordan Montgomery are still out there, of course, and I am at peace with the fact that the team isn’t looking to commit to the type of long-term deals those two are seeking.

But Jake Odorizzi, who spent all of 2023 on the 60 day injured list for the Rangers, is apparently healthy and throwing for teams. Texas acquired him with the plan for him to be a long man/sixth starter last year. You mean to tell me the Rangers wouldn’t be interested in Odorizzi on a one year, low base deal?

Maybe Michael Lorenzen? Mike Clevinger? The ageless Zack Greinke? Even someone like Zach Davies on a minor league deal?

Surely, the Rangers will get someone in here in the next week or two. That’s what I keep thinking.

The alternative? The alternative is that the Rangers feel that they need to give some of the young starters currently in the organization a chance. They need to let Cody Bradford start every fifth day. They feel confident that someone like White or Kent or Leiter can step up and fill in as needed, and that the team needs guys like that to establish themselves, so that they aren’t going out every offseason trying to fill their rotation holes in the free agent market. They feel the team is strong enough, overall, and the internal options are good enough, and the expanded playoffs provide enough opportunities, that they can ride things out with the status quo until the injured pitchers start returning.
